Carola of Vasa

Carola of Vasa

Princess Carola of Sweden or of Vasa ("Caroline Friederike Franziska Stephanie Amelie Cecilie") (5 August, 1833 at Schonbrunn – 15 December, 1907 at Dresden) was a princess of Sweden and queen consort of Saxony. She was the daughter of the former Crown Prince Gustav of Sweden and Princess Luise Amelie Stephanie of Baden, and a granddaughter of King Gustav IV Adolf of Sweden who had been deposed in 1809.

In the early 1850s, she was considered one of the most beautiful royal princesses of Europe. Suitors were not lacking, and there had been plans for her to marry Napoléon III, Emperor of the French. She was a cousin of the Emperor's through her maternal grandmother Stéphanie de Beauharnais. Her father was against the marriage due to the volatile political situation in France and his dynasty's historical dispute with the Napoleon monarchy. 20 years later, when Napoleon III fell from power, her father is quoted as saying, "I foresaw that correctly!"

In 1852, against her father's wishes, Carola converted to Catholicism. On 18 June, 1853, Carola married Crown Prince Albert of Saxony, who later succeeded his father as King Albert I. Their marriage was childless. Her closest heirs were: in paternal side, Frederick II, Grand Duke of Baden (1857-1928), son of her first cousin; and her first cousin King Carol I of Romania (1839-1914) in maternal side.
